Vinod Khosla comes to Disrupt to discuss how artificial intelligence can change the future

Few figures in the technology industry have earned the storied reputation of Vinod Khosla, founder and partner of Khosla Ventures. For more than 40 years, it has been at the center of Silicon Valley, building or supporting some of the largest and most influential technology companies. His career dates back to his days as the founder of Sun Microsystems and spans decades of business investment. Khosla’s firm today is known for its stakes in companies such as Affirm, Block, DoorDash, GitLab, Okta and Opendoor, to name a few of its hundreds of successful portfolio companies.

These days, he’s at the center of OpenAI as one of the first VCs to back the company, writing a $50 million check in 2019, years before ChatGPT caught the world’s attention.

Always focused on the future, Khosla will be our guest in a must-see keynote session at TechCrunch Disrupt 2024 this October, where he will discuss the major tech trends that are changing our lives.

Khosla believes that artificial intelligence will change the structure of human society, allowing 7 billion people to live as 700 million live. He sees a future where artificial intelligence provides unlimited doctors, teachers and workers. And it invests in technologies that change our food and the economies that produce it, that produce new medicines and treatments, and in new building and construction materials.

This wave of change will come with its own set of issues, he warns: job displacement, inequality, terrorism and misregulation.

But ultimately he says he’s optimistic about what’s possible, and to those who want to be a part of this powerful new future, he’ll share advice on what to do now.
